## Lost Badge? Here's the drill

If someone turns up badgeless, don't just wave them through. Check their name against the Timberlane staff list, disable the old badge in Gatewise straight away, and issue a one-day temp card. Log it all in the tracker — no exceptions, even for directors. To activate the temp card at the encoder, punch in the code below.

staff pass of kawip-hawef = bdg-QLP-2

Ticket: Tallyshade's formula sandbox is disabled on the QA environment because the sandbox broker credential was never provisioned there, so user-supplied formulas currently evaluate unsandboxed. This is unacceptable even in QA. Future maintainers: whenever you clone an environment, verify the broker entry exists before enabling formula input. To remediate QA now, append this line to its env file:

vault entry, kahip-fahog: RELAY_SECRET20=6a2c791de808f35c3b55

Action item: The Relayn deploy-status bot silently dropped updates when the pipeline API paginated results, so responders believed a rollback had completed when it had not. We will add pagination handling, a staleness banner, and an integration test. Until merged, verify deploy state directly in the pipeline console, documented at the page below.

runbook for kahop-kajop: https://rundeck.ordinio.test/display/secrets/pipeline/issue/pages/repo/browse/e5732776e07d1285107e5aeb